Angel Reese Has Officially Been Traded In Blockbuster Deal
Angel Reese is headed to a new team.
The Chicago Sky has traded the star forward of the Atlanta Dream. This will move the two-time All-Star to Atlanta after two seasons in Chicago.

FULL TRADE DETAILS:
Dream receive:
Angel Reese
2028 second-round pick swap
Sky receive:
2027 first-round pick
2028 first-round pick
Reese and the Chicago Sky did not have the 2025 WNBA season they hoped for, finishing the year with a 10-34 record and missing the playoffs for a second consecutive season.
Angel Reese and The Chicago Sky Had Tension In 2025
Reese was suspended by the Chicago Sky for a game in September. It was due to “statements detrimental to the team.” These comments included criticisms of teammates and team facilities, for which she later apologized.
In the weeks following, she would show how much she wanted to get away from the franchise. Once she was drafted, she changed her nickname to “Chi-Town Barbie.” The nickname became popular after she was drafted by the Chicago Sky and was highlighted on the team’s official social media accounts, including Instagram.
After her suspension, she removed that name. Reese was even accused of faking injuries to avoid playing for the team.
A WNBA executive has even urged Reese to request a trade from the Chicago Sky this offseason. “She needs to get the hell out of there,” the WNBA exec told DallasHoopsJournal.
WNBA star Angel Reese returned to the Unrivaled 3-on-3 league last month. She joined Rose BC as a mid-season addition and immediately contributed with averages of over 13 points and 10 rebounds per game. The inaugural 2025 Defensive Player of the Year helped make the team competitive after its rough start. Unfortunately, the team was not good enough to win the title for the second straight season.
Off the court, she has been making waves in the world of fashion. Reese has established herself as a major fashion icon in professional sports. She became the first WNBA player to walk in the Victoria’s Secret Fashion Show. Reese was also featured on the winter 2025 cover of Vogue.
Now the next time she gets on the court, it’ll be with the Atlanta Dream.
